ArmInfo. The youth of the Union of Armenians of Russia (UAR) qualifies
the reception at the Turkish embassy on April 24 as intentional
sacrilege and calls on foreign countries’ ambassadors to boycott the
event which insults the memory of 1.5 mln innocent victims of the
Armenian Genocide.

The UAR youth’s statement sent to ArmInfo says that on April 24, 1915,
the Turkish authorities arrested and savagely killed the best sons of
Armenian people, the elite of intellectuals. Armenians were massacred
in their Motherland – Western Armenia. Carrying out their plan of
ethnic cleansing, the Turkish authorities ordered to exterminate
Armenians. Neither women, nor children, nor elderly people were
spared. Over 1 500 000 people were killed.

The rest became refugees all over the world. Cities and villages of
the country, the area of which was 10 times as large as the one of
modern Armenia, became empty. The international community condemned
this monstrous misdeed. Russia, France, Germany, Canada, Switzerland,
the Netherlands, Belgium, Uruguay, Cyprus, Greece, Lebanon, Italy,
Argentina, Slovakia, Poland, Lithuania, Venezuela and other countries
fixed with state acts their position of recognition and condemnation
of the Armenian Genocide committed by Turkey. However, even now that
93 years have passed since the tragedy, Turkey itself has no desire
to recognize the fact of the Armenian Genocide it committed. Only
condemnation of the crime can prevent similar crimes.

"The solemn reception to be organized by the Turkish ambassador on
April 24, the Day of Grief is intentional sacrilege. We appeal to you
not to participate in the provocative event which insults the memory
of 1.5 mln innocent victims", the statement says.

YEREVAN, APRIL 22, NOYAN TAPAN. Since April 21, 2008 the government of
the Republic of Armenia is considered to be formed, as all the members
of the government have been appointed. According to the information
provided to Noyan Tapan by the RA President’s Press Office, according
to order envisaged by Article 74 of the RA Constitution, the government
will submit its program to the National Assembly for approval within
a 20-day term.

According to the same source, Andranik Manukian and Manuk Topuzian
have been appointed advisers of RA President by the decrees signed
by President Serge Sargsian on April 21.

By the April 21 two orders of the RA President, Levon Martirosian
has been appointed assistant of RA President and Samvel Farmanian
seminar reader of RA President.

YEREVAN, APRIL 21, ARMENPRESS: Armenian President Serzh Sargsian signed
today a decree appointing Armen Gevorgian as Territorial Governance
Minister of Armenia. Presidential press service told Armenpress that
with another decree the president appointed Armen Gevorgian as deputy
prime minister.

A. Gevorgian was born in 1973 in Yerevan. He studied in Orenburg
State Pedagogical Institute majoring in history. Graduated from
St. Petersburg state service institute.

>From 1997 January to 1998 April was the aide to the Armenian prime
minister. From April 13 1998 held the office of the aide to the
president and first deputy of the president’s staff.

>From 2000-2006 was the first aide to the president.

In February 2006 was appointed the head of staff of the president. From
January 2007 is also holding office of the secretary of the National
Security Council. He is married has two sons.

Day.Az interview with Ilham Mamedov, first deputy of Azerbaijan’s
Military Prosecutor, head of joint operative group on investigation
of crimes, committed during Armenia’s aggression against Azerbaijan.

-How does the investigation of crimes, committed by Armenians in
Khojaly, proceed?

-The case on the said fact was closed in March of 1994 due to
impossibility to reveal persons who committed the said crime. Yet we
restarted the said case after the Constitutional law was adopted and
re-qualified it into genocide in line with article 103 of the Criminal
Code. After we started to regard these events on basis of the existing
materials of the case and collected evidences as an international
crime, as all objective data give us grounds to say like that.

We have repeatedly appealed to our colleagues to Russian prosecutor’s
office in Moscow in connection with this case. We have helped us
in most issues, sent materials of the criminal case. We collected
other evidences, started to question witnesses, held expertise,
that is started to conduct procedure actions. Today, we have already
presented accusations to 37 persons on facts of crimes in Khojaly. All
these people are direct executers, who killed, attacked children,
women and elderly people. Among them, there were servicemen of the
well-known 366th division.

The evidences regarding the said 37 people were contained in the
initial materials of the case. We have managed to reveal them on
basis of witnesses of people who managed to survive in this hell.

Today, we base on the norms of international law, which allow us to
hold such kinds of investigation. On the other hand, the European
convention and European Court are, as we think, guarantors of our
application of norms of international law, our responsibility as a
state, which is bound to prevent such crimes and gives the right to
those persons, whom we brought to criminal responsibility, to appeal
to the European Court.

I would repeat that the international convention demands from us to
investigate such a case. Moreover, the state is bound to cooperate
with other states in the resolution of this issue.

-Does the list of these 37 people contain persons, who led the
separatist movement in Karabakh?

-I want the community not to confuse these two categories: separatist
leaders and criminals. We do not pursue people who think differently,
we pursue those who are criminals in the framework of international
criminal law. The convention is fixing these two concepts separately.

-However, the former president of Armenia Robert Kocharyan stated
openly that he is proud of having participated in the liberation
of Shusha.

-We have not yet given legal assessment to whether he has participated
or not. This is quite a different question. We consider the question
from the point of view of international criminal law. Of course, if
evidences proving participation of Kocharyan or any other person in
this crimes are collected, they will be brought to responsibility. For
bringing this or that person to a criminal responsibility, we can
not adhere to emotions or any unchecked information.

I would like to stress the role of European Court in this issue. The
European legal area, whom Azerbaijan is an element to and by the way
Armenia, is quite a new element for us, which lays responsibility on
officials and law enforcement bodies. In this case we can only speak
about law.

-Anyway, following the recent elections in Armenia, the list of the
so-called "Karabakh clan" included those who fight against Azerbaijan
with guns in their hands. This is the currently president of the
country S.Sarkissyan, Minister of Defense Oganyan and others. Does the
military prosecutor’s office have any facts regarding these people,
which prove that they committed crimes against the Azerbaijani people?

-First of all, to elect a president is a business of people. I
think the opinion of the Azerbaijani people appeared during the
elections. As we see, not everyone supports the aggressive policy
of the country’s leadership, as there are many people, who adhere to
democratic principles.

Anyway, we will have to live with Armenians and those Armenians,
who lived and live in Nagorno Karabakh are our citizens and we are
responsible for ensuring their rights.

We fight not against Armenians. We fight against military criminals.

-What can you say about investigation of crimes, connected with
brutal attitude to Azerbaijani citizens, captured during the Karabakh
conflict?

-29 people were brought to responsibility on this fact. These were
Armenian natives who violated norms of humanitarian law, that is those
who took direct part in tortures. Such crimes were committed against at
least 1378 Azerbaijani citizens whom we managed to free from captivity.

Turkey’s Foreign Minister Ali Babacan said on Monday the country’s
EU membership is a win-win procedure for Turkey and EU.

Babacan spoke to guests at opening of Turkish-Austrian Neighborhood
Workshop in Ankara.

Babacan said Turkey implemented remarkable political reforms and
made important steps in its EU bid, and will continue to do so. He
thanked Austria for its support to Turkey’s EU membership. "Both
Turkey and Austria pursued a stable foreign policy in a geography
full of challenges and opportunities," Babacan added.

Regarding the partnership agreement that was expected to be signed by
EU and Bosnia-Herzegovina Babacan said, "Turkey has been carefully
monitoring developments in Bosnia- Herzegovina and the parnetship
agreement is of great importance for Turkey."

"Preserving peace and stability in Balkans is a priority for Turkey,"
Babacan continued adding that "Turkey highly value Kosovo and there
were close ties between the two countries."

Turkish FM called for eliminating fragmentation among Palestinians
for the sake of peace process, saying, "The Palestine issue was the
main problem in the Middle East"

On relations with Armenia, Babacan said "Turkey is eager to normalize
its relations with Armenia. It keeps open dialogue channels with the
new Armenian government."

YEREVAN, APRIL 21, ARMENPRESS: Armenia’s economy grew 10.2 percent
in quarter one. In January-February the growth was 10.1 percent.

Armenian Central Bank said the highest growth rate-20 percent- was
again reported by construction sector.

Industrial growth was 5.8 percent aided significantly by growth in
energy, food and metal production sectors. Growth in services was
11.2 percent. High growth rates were reported both in retail trade
and services.

Agriculture rose 3.2 percent.

/PanARMENIAN.Net/ A torch procession that has already become a
tradition will be held in Yerevan under the slogan "My name is
struggle, my death is victory" to commemorate victims of the Armenian
Genocide at the hands of the Ottoman Empire in 1915.

The procession will start at Liberty Square on April 23 at 8.00
p.m. and will finish at Tsitsernakaberd memorial complex, reports
the Press Center of the Youth Wing of ARF Dashnaktsutyun and Nikol
Aghbalyan student union.

The initiators of the event call on Yerevan residents to light candles
on their windowsills to commemorate the Genocide victims

The newly appointed Ambassador of Turkmenistan to Armenia Shohrat
Jumayev presented his credentials to RA President Serzh Sargsyan.

The President congratulated the Ambassador on assuming office and
expressed hope that new steps will be made during his tenure in office
in the direction of expanding the bilateral relations.

Underscoring the warm relations established between Armenia and
Turkmenistan and the great potential of development of the two
countries, the interlocutors prioritized the deepening of further
cooperation in the field of economy.

Noting that the Armenian-Turkmen trade-economic indices do not
reflect the existing potential, President Sargsyan attached particular
importance to the restart of the work of the joint Intergovernmental
Commission and promotion of active cooperation in the field of economy.

The rise in gas price has aroused serious concern and complaint not
only in the capital but also in RA marzes. Residents of Armavir Marz
mainly complain of unemployment. "We cannot afford communal services
as we are unemployed. There are hardly any workplaces in the marz,"
they say. Most young people have decided to leave Armenia as they
are sure that prices of most consumer goods will go up.

Pensioners consider the recent rise in gas price a "barbarism." "They
pledged we should lead a better life. We hardly survive today," they
say. They spent their monthly pension, 30-45 000 drams, on gas during
the winter months.

Rafik Ghazarian, Head of the Armavir-based "ArmRusGasArt" Ltd, says
that Armenia’s Government will take complex measures targeted at
the vulnerable layer of the society to protect them from the rise
of tariffs.
